Specifications
Current - Output (Max): 132mA
Size / Dimension: 0.77" L x 0.39" W x 0.49" H (19.5mm x 9.8mm x 12.5mm)
Package / Case: 7-SIP Module, 4 Leads
Mounting Type: Through Hole
Efficiency: 80%
Operating Temperature: -40°C ~ 85°C
Features: SCP
Applications: ITE (Commercial), Medical
Voltage - Isolation: 6.4kV
Power (Watts): 2W
Series: ECONOLINE RxxP2xx
Voltage - Output 3: --
Voltage - Output 2: --
Voltage - Output 1: 15V
Voltage - Input (Max): 13.2V
Voltage - Input (Min): 10.8V
Number of Outputs: 1
Type: Isolated Module
Part Status: Active
Packaging: Tube
